Ibrahim Mansoor: After what felt like an eternity of waiting (a month to be exact), our anticipation for our visit to Moona, an Eastern Mediterranean & Arabic restaurant, reached its peak. This intimate, mosaic-tiled gem is perfect for any occasion, but it's especially ideal for date nights.Four of us embarked on this flavorful adventure and the place was bustling with patrons throughout our two and a half hour culinary escapade. We decided to embrace the communal dining spirit by ordering and sharing dishes instead of going the traditional appetizer and main course route.Round 1:Dips Plate (mustard labneh, hummus, smoked baba, olives, pickles)Batata Harra (spicy crispy potatoes, cilantro, and lemon)Fattoush SaladThe smoked baba ganoush stole the spotlight, seducing our palates with its irresistible smokiness. The Fattoush Salad was a reliable choice, and the Batata Harra was a revelation - crispy, tangy, and just the right amount of heat. Hot potatoes indeed!Round 2:4. Msakhan Duck RollsEggplant FattehMushroom FarroLamb BurgerRound 2 was a battle between the Eggplant Fatteh and the Lamb Burger, both of which emerged as the undisputed stars of this round. The Lamb Burger's perfect harmony of flavors and textures made us swoon, while the Eggplant Fatteh's delectable layers had us speechless. The Mushroom Farro and the spicy Duck Rolls were also a delightful addition to our gastronomic odyssey.Round 3:Slow-cooked Lamb ShoulderAs a self-proclaimed lamb connoisseur, I can attest that Moona's slow-cooked lamb shoulder was nothing short of heavenly. It was so good that my inner carnivore emerged and devoured the plate in no time. The added touch of dates was surprisingly delightful, making it a true symphony of flavors.Round 4 (Desserts):Hallawa Cheesecake & KunafehI'm usually quite picky when it comes to desserts, but Moona's Hallawa Cheesecake and Kunafeh had me singing their praises. Both were stunningly delicious and served as the perfect finale to our feast.To wash everything down, I indulged in a pomegranate, cardamom, and mint lemonade mocktail. Whoever came up with this concoction deserves a medal – I had four refills and could have easily had more!Despite the packed house, the service was decent, and our food arrived with fairly good timing. Just remember to be patient and perhaps order some appetizers if you're on the verge of being hangry.Lastly, we recommend taking an Uber to Moona, as parking might be a bit of a challenge. Overall, we were thoroughly impressed with Moona's ambiance, menu, and the talents of the chefs. We can't wait to return and explore the rest of the menu!
